Energy Supplier innogy Boosts Innovation and Sustainability, Cuts Complexity Using AWS

innogy is the leading natural gas provider in the Czech Republic. It’s also an innovator, delivering clean mobility solutions and cutting-edge energy services that help customers live more sustainably. To do this it needs a modern infrastructure. Having migrated from its on-premises environment to Amazon Web Services (AWS), the organization has greater flexibility in application development. Its developers can access tools to create new experiences for customers—such as chatbot functionality to boost call center operations—and explore other AI use cases. Here, IT infrastructure senior manager Petr Bohac talks about the benefit of a secure, modern cloud environment for innogy and its customers.
